Can I use a hair dryer to dry my documents?
No. Using a hair dryer can cause further damage and create a humid environment that promotes mold and mildew growth. Our team will use specialized equipment to dry your documents safely and effectively.
How can I prevent water damage to my documents in the future?
Proper storage and handling are key. Keep your documents in a dry, cool place, away from direct sunlight. Avoid stacking documents, and use acid-free materials to prevent damage.
